According to the first definition in Black’s Law Dictionary she is not. To be eligible for president you must be a PERSON.

From Black’s definition of PERSON:

“A MAN considered according to the rank he holds in society, with all the rights to which the place he holds entitles him, and the duties which it imposes.”

Unfortunately, it then goes on to reference Bouvier’s Law Dictionary of 1856:

“A human being considered as capable of having rights and of being charged with duties; while a “thing” is the object over which rights may be exercised.”

Going to the Bouvier dictionary, that has additional info:

“This word is applied to men, women and children, who are called natural persons.”

Sorry, but legally a non-starter. In fact, he could run for VP, and she ceased to be able to be Pres, he would elevate to that position.

No person shall be ELECTED to the office of the President more than twice, and no person who has held the office of President, or acted as President, for more than two years of a term to which some other person was elected President shall be elected to the office of the President more than once. But this article shall not apply to any person holding the office of President when this article was proposed by the Congress, and shall not prevent any person who may be holding the office of President, or acting as President, during the term within which this article becomes operative from holding the office of President or acting as President during the remainder of such term.
